
Juvenile Myasthenia Gravis: Diagnosis and Outcome
Abstract
The usefulness of various diagnostic tests, treatment, and outcome in 27 juvenile myasthenics seen over a 25 year period are reported from the Departments of Pediatrics, Neurology, and Anatomy, University of Iowa.
